Agreed. I love the S2 cab. Arguably inferior to the 968 but have you seen the difference in parts prices?

The 968 engine/drivetrain is somewhat more evolved, but fundamentally the same. The S2 is probably 80% of the 968, mostly different sheet metal and a slightly different looking interior. In fact the 968 was originally called "mostly new" by Porsche (which probably contributed to its short production run) and was originally going to be branded the S3.

I'd buy either. I very seriously looked at an S2 cabrio after my 951 burned up but opted for the 911 instead. I guarantee there's either a 968 or an S2 (probably a 968) in my future as a present for the wife. I almost bought her a 968 some years ago (should have). In time...

There's a 2001 (C5) Z06 for sale by me for $18,000. 2001 had the smaller engine than Z06's in later years, but it's still good for 385 hp.

I wouldn't touch a "regular" C5 Corvette.

The C6 Corvettes are up to 450 hp for the base model, 550 hp for the Z06, and 650 for the ZR1.
